Abstract
Introduction Laparoscopy in gallbladder cancer (GBC) has a possible role in staging, radical cure, and palliation in gallbladder cancer. However, a few studies have advocated the use of laparoscopic approach and concluded the safety of this approach. This present study was undertaken to determine the safety and feasibility between open and laparoscopic cholecystectomy in patients with the non-metastatic GBC. Materials and Methods A systematic database search was performed in MEDLINE, Embase, and Google Scholar for relevant articles. As a result, a list of such studies, clinical trials, published in English up to May 2021, was obtained,14 studies were included and statistical analysis was conducted using RevMan software 5.3 (The Nordic Cochrane Centre). Results The 5-year survival rate was reported in 13 out of 14 studies (1388 patients), and all compared laparoscopic and open approach. There was no significant heterogeneity in between the studies (chi-square, 10.66; df, 12; I2, 0%). There was significant higher overall survival in open group (389/850 vs 194/538 or 1.45, 95% CI (1.12-1.88), P value, 0.005). There was no significant difference in recurrence rate, operative time, blood loss, lymph node yield, and postoperative complication in between open and laparoscopic groups. Conclusions Our present study demonstrates that overall survival is significantly increased with open approach when compared with laparoscopic approach. There is no difference in recurrence rate, operative time, blood loss, lymph node yield, and postoperative complications between the open and laparoscopic cholecystectomy groups.

Abstract
Gallbladder cancer (GBC) is an extremely lethal malignancy with aggressive behaviors, including liver or distant metastasis; however, the underlying mechanisms driving the metastasis of GBC remain poorly understood. In this study, it is found that DNA methyltransferase DNMT3A is highly expressed in GBC tumor tissues compared to matched adjacent normal tissues. Clinicopathological analysis shows that DNMT3A is positively correlated with liver metastasis and poor overall survival outcomes in patients with GBC. Functional analysis confirms that DNMT3A promotes the metastasis of GBC cells in a manner dependent on its DNA methyltransferase activity. Mechanistically, DNMT3A interacts with and is recruited by YAP/TAZ to recognize and access the CpG island within the CDH1 promoter and generates hypermethylation of the CDH1 promoter, which leads to transcriptional silencing of CDH1 and accelerated epithelial-to-mesenchymal transition. Using tissue microarrays, the association between the expression of DNMT3A, YAP/TAZ, and CDH1 is confirmed, which affects the metastatic ability of GBC. These results reveal a novel mechanism through which DNMT3A recruitment by YAP/TAZ guides DNA methylation to drive GBC metastasis and provide insights into the treatment of GBC metastasis by targeting the functional connection between DNMT3A and YAP/TAZ.

Abstract
INTRODUCTION Gallbladder cancer is a rare malignancy and double cancer of the gallbladder is extremely rare. Biliary tree malignancies including cholangiocarcinoma and gallbladder cancer are aggressive cancers and have a poor prognosis. This reports a rare case of double adenocarcinoma of the gallbladder. PRESENTATION OF CASE A 77-year old woman with a cholelithiasis and decreased body weight was diagnosed with rapidly growing gallbladder tumor by abdominal computed tomography scan. A combined resection of the gallbladder, extrahepatic bile duct, segments 4a and 5 of the liver and regional lymph node dissection were performed. Pathologic examination revealed double poorly differentiated adenocarcinoma of the gallbladder. The patient had no evidence of recurrence for 40 months after resection. DISCUSSION This patient had double cancer of the gallbladder. Gallbladder cancer is an aggressive cancer and has a poor prognosis. The only curative therapy is radical resection. In this patient, radical laparotomy and adjuvant chemotherapy were performed. The pathological diagnosis of the resected specimen was double cancer of the gallbladder. CONCLUSION This is a report of rapidly growing double cancer of the gallbladder. Patients with gallbladder cancer may benefit from aggressive surgical resection and adjuvant chemotherapy.

Abstract
OBJECTIVE The aim of this study was to develop and validate a clinical prediction model to predict overall survival in patients with nonmetastatic, resected gallbladder cancer (GBC). BACKGROUND Although several tools are available, no optimal method has been identified to assess survival in patients with resected GBC. METHODS Data from a Dutch, nation-wide cohort of patients with resected GBC was used to develop a prediction model for overall survival. The model was internally validated and a cohort of Australian GBC patients who underwent resection was used for external validation. The performance of the American Joint Committee on Cancer (AJCC) staging system and the present model were compared. RESULTS In total, 446 patients were included; 380 patients in the development cohort and 66 patients in the validation cohort. In the development cohort median survival was 22 months (median follow-up 75 months). Age, T/N classification, resection margin, differentiation grade, and vascular invasion were independent predictors of survival. The externally validated C-index was 0.75 (95%CI: 0.69-0.80), implying good discriminatory capacity. The discriminative ability of the present model after internal validation was superior to the ability of the AJCC staging system (Harrell C-index 0.71, [95%CI: 0.69-0.72) vs. 0.59 (95% CI: 0.57-0.60)]. CONCLUSION The proposed model for the prediction of overall survival in patients with resected GBC demonstrates good discriminatory capacity, reasonable calibration and outperforms the authoritative AJCC staging system. Abstract
Objective The aim of this study was to develop and validate a nomogram to predict the overall survival of incidental gallbladder cancer. Methods A total of 383 eligible patients with incidental gallbladder cancer diagnosed in Shanghai Eastern Hepatobiliary Surgery Hospital from 2011 to 2021 were retrospectively included. They were randomly divided into a training cohort (70%) and a validation cohort (30%). Univariate and multivariate analyses and the Akaike information criterion were used to identify variables independently associated with overall survival. A Cox proportional hazards model was used to construct the nomogram. The C-index, area under time-dependent receiver operating characteristic curves and calibration curves were used to evaluate the discrimination and calibration of the nomogram. Results T stage, N metastasis, peritoneal metastasis, reresection and histology were independent prognostic factors for overall survival. Based on these predictors, a nomogram was successfully established. The C-index of the nomogram in the training cohort and validation cohort was 0.76 and 0.814, respectively. The AUCs of the nomogram in the training cohort were 0.8, 0.819 and 0.815 for predicting OS at 1, 3 and 5 years, respectively, while the AUCs of the nomogram in the validation cohort were 0.846, 0.845 and 0.902 for predicting OS at 1, 3 and 5 years, respectively. Compared with the 8th AJCC staging system, the AUCs of the nomogram in the present study showed a better discriminative ability. Calibration curves for the training and validation cohorts showed excellent agreement between the predicted and observed outcomes at 1, 3 and 5 years. Conclusions The nomogram in this study showed excellent discrimination and calibration in predicting overall survival in patients with incidental gallbladder cancer. It is useful for physicians to obtain accurate long-term survival information and to help them make optimal treatment and follow-up decisions.

Abstract
Background: Portal lymphadenectomy (PLND) is the current standard for oncologic resection of biliary tract cancers (BTCs). However, published data show it is performed infrequently and often yields less than the recommended 6 lymph nodes. We sought to identify yield and outcomes using a Clockwise Anterior-to-Posterior technique with Double Isolation of critical structures (CAP-DI) for PLND. Methods: Consecutive patients undergoing complete PLND for BTCs using CAP-DI technique were identified (2015−2021). Lymph node (LN) yield and predictors of LN count were examined. Secondary outcomes included intraoperative and postoperative outcomes, which were compared to patients having hepatectomy without PLND. Results: In total, 534 patients were included; 71 with complete PLND (36 gallbladder cancers, 24 intrahepatic cholangiocarcinomas, 11 perihilar cholangiocarcinomas) and 463 in the control group. The median PLND yield was 5 (IQR 3−8; range 0−17) and 46% had at least 6 nodes retrieved. Older age was associated with lower likelihood of ≥6 node PLND yield (p = 0.032), which remained significant in bivariate analyses with other covariates (p < 0.05). After adjustment for operative factors, performance of complete PLND was independently associated with longer operative time (+46.4 min, p = 0.001), but no differences were observed in intraoperative or postoperative outcomes compared to the control group (p > 0.05). Conclusions: Yield following PLND frequently falls below the recommended minimum threshold of 6 nodes despite a standardized stepwise approach to complete clearance. Older age may be weakly associated with lower PLND yield. While all efforts should be made for complete node retrieval, failure to obtain 6 nodes may be an unrealistic metric of surgical quality.

Abstract
BACKGROUND Sequential extended cholecystectomy (SEC) is currently recommended for T2 and higher gallbladder cancer (GBC) diagnosed after simple cholecystectomy (SC), but the value and timing of re-resection has not been fully studied. We evaluated the long-term oncologic outcomes of T2 GBC according to the type of surgery performed and investigated the optimal timing for SEC. METHODS Patients diagnosed with T2 GBC who underwent SC, extended cholecystectomy (EC), or SEC between 2002 and 2017 were retrospectively reviewed. Those who underwent other surgical procedures or those with incomplete medical records were excluded. Overall survival (OS) and disease-free survival (DFS) according to the types of surgeries and prognostic factors for OS and DFS were analyzed. Survival analysis was done between groups that were divided according to the optimal cutoff time interval between SC and SEC based on DFS data. RESULTS Of the 226 T2 GBC patients, 53, 173, and 44 underwent SC, EC, and SEC, respectively. The 5-year OS rate was 50.1%, 73.2%, and 78.7%, and the DFS rate was 46.8%, 66.3%, and 65.2% in the SC, EC, and SEC groups, respectively. EC (p = 0.001 and p = 0.001) and SEC (p = 0.007 and p = 0.065) groups had better 5-year OS and DFS rates than the SC group. Preoperative CA 19-9 level > 37 U/mL (HR 1.56; 95% CI 1.87-2.79; p < 0.001) and N1 stage (HR 2.88; 95% CI 1.76-4.71; p < 0.001) were associated with poorer prognosis. The optimal cutoff interval between SC and SEC was 28 days. Patients who underwent SEC ≤ 28 days after the initial cholecystectomy had better 5-year DFS rates than patients who underwent SEC after > 28 days (75.0% vs. 52.8%, p = 0.023). CONCLUSIONS SEC is recommended for T2 GBC diagnosed after SC, because SEC provides better survival outcomes than SC alone. A time interval of less than 28 days to SEC is associated with an improved DFS.

Abstract
Background Gallbladder cancer (GBC) with liver metastasis is considered unresectable. However, there have been infrequent reports of long-term survival in patients with GBC and liver metastases. Therefore, we examined the characteristics of long-term survivors of gallbladder cancer with liver metastasis. Methods A retrospective multicenter study of 462 patients with GBC (mean age, 71 years; female, 51%) was performed. Although patients with pre-operatively diagnosed GBC and liver metastasis were generally excluded from resection, some cases identified during surgery were resected. Result In patients with resected stage III/IV GBC (n = 193), the period 2007–2013 (vs. 2000–2006, hazard ratio 0.63), pre-operative jaundice (hazard ratio 1.70), ≥ 2 liver metastases (vs. no liver metastasis, hazard ratio 2.11), and metastasis to the peritoneum (vs. no peritoneal metastasis, hazard ratio 2.08) were independent prognostic factors for overall survival, whereas one liver metastasis (vs. no liver metastasis) was not. When examining the 5-year overall survival and median survival times by liver metastasis in patients without peritoneal metastasis or pre-operative jaundice, those with one liver metastasis (63.5%, not reached) were comparable to those without liver metastasis (40.4%, 33.0 months), and was better than those with ≥ 2 liver metastases although there was no statistical difference (16.7%, 9.0 months). According to the univariate analysis of resected patients with GBC and liver metastases (n = 26), minor hepatectomy, less blood loss, less surgery time, papillary adenocarcinoma, and T2 were significantly associated with longer survival. Morbidity of Clavien–Dindo classification ≤ 2 and received adjuvant chemotherapy were marginally not significant. Long-term survivors (n = 5) had a high frequency of T2 tumors (4/5), had small liver metastases near the gallbladder during or after surgery, underwent minor hepatectomy without postoperative complications, and received postoperative adjuvant chemotherapy. Conclusions Although there is no surgical indication for GBC with liver metastasis diagnosed pre-operatively, minor hepatectomy and postoperative chemotherapy may be an option for selected patients with T2 GBC and liver metastasis identified during or after surgery who do not have other poor prognostic factors. Abstract
OBJECTIVE This study aimed to identify reliable predictors of disease progression in patients with gallbladder (GB) adenocarcinoma. PATIENTS AND METHODS A total of 54 patients with GB adenocarcinoma underwent preoperative F-18 fluorodeoxyglucose (FDG) PET/CT. Age, sex, clinical stage, and pathologic differentiation were collected. Tumor size and PET parameters such as SUVmax, SUVmean, SUVpeak, metabolic tumor volume (MTV), and total lesion glycolysis were measured. Univariate and multivariate logistic regression analyses were performed to determine the utility of clinical values and PET parameters. Pearson bivariate correlation was used to evaluate the association between progression-free survival (PFS) and various parameters. RESULTS No recurrence was found in 15 of 54 patients, while six showed recurrence and another 33 manifested disease progression. There were significant differences in size, stage, pathologic differentiation, and PET parameters between the groups with and without recurrence/progression. However, there was no difference in those parameters between the groups with recurrence and progression. The average PFS of the groups with no recurrence, recurrence, and progression groups was 33.1, 17.1, and 5.0 months, respectively. In univariate analysis, age, sex, clinical stage, pathologic differentiation, size, and PET parameters were correlated with PFS. In multivariate analysis, only clinical stage and MTV were statistically significant and MTV showed the highest odds ratio. Pearson correlation coefficients showed moderate negative correlations between PFS and clinical stage or MTV. CONCLUSION In GB adenocarcinoma, clinical stage and MTV are the most powerful parameters for predicting recurrence and disease progression. Based on clinical stage, MTV will represent a strong prognostic predictor.

Abstract
BACKGROUND Current AJCC guidelines recommend evaluating ≥6 lymph nodes during gallbladder cancer resection but real world data suggest this is rarely achieved. We evaluated the extent of lymphadenectomy and survival among patients with gallbladder adenocarcinoma. METHODS Patients with resected pT1b-T3 gallbladder adenocarcinoma were identified from the NCDB (2004-2017). Propensity scores were created for the odds of sufficient lymphadenectomy (≥6 nodes), patients were matched 1:1 and survival was analyzed using the Kaplan-Meier method. RESULTS Overall, 4760 patients were identified: 16.7% underwent sufficient lymphadenectomy, which was predictive of nodal disease (OR 1.77, 95%CI 1.51-2.08) and demonstrated a survival benefit in N0 (median OS 140.8 versus 44.4 months; p < 0.0001) and N1-2 disease (median OS 27.7 versus 17.7 months; p < 0.0001) after matching. CONCLUSIONS The majority of patients with gallbladder adenocarcinoma do not undergo the recommended nodal dissection, resulting in a survival disadvantage, likely due to understaging, decisions regarding adjuvant therapy and local tumor recurrence.

Abstract
Background It remains unclear whether lymph node dissection is necessary for patients with N0 gallbladder carcinoma (GBC). The objective of this study was to evaluate the effect of lymphadenectomy on the prognosis for N0 GBC patients. The secondary objective was to establish a prognostic model of survival for N0 GBC patients being founded on the large samples. Methods Patient data were obtained from the database named SEER (Surveillance, Epidemiology, and End Results database) between 2010 and 2014. Analyses of Kaplan–Meier survival and multivariate Cox regression were performed in subgroups based on regional lymph nodes removal (LNR) to calculate the excess risk of cause‐specific death. A prognosis nomogram was constructed build on the results of a multivariate analysis to predict the specific survival time (CSS) rates of N0 GBC patients. Result A total of 1406 N0 GBC patients were included in this research. The majority of N0 GBC patients undergoing cancer‐directed surgery did not undergo LNR (64.5%). The results showed that LNR can improve the survival of N0 GBC patients, including those at the T1a and T1b stages, and a wider range of lymph node dissection (LNR2) compared to LNR1 was more conducive to the prognosis. Furthermore, multivariate regression analysis showed that LNR was an independent favorable prognostic factor of N0 GBC. Finally, a nomogram was constructed to accurately predict the prognosis of N0 gallbladder cancer patients. Conclusion This study demonstrated a significant survival benefit for extended lymph nodes removed in N0 GBC patients. These results recommend that an extended lymph node dissection strategy is needed for N0 GBC patients.

Abstract
BACKGROUND The importance of regional lymph node sampling (LNS) during resection of hepatocellular carcinoma (HCC) is poorly understood. This study sought to ameliorate this knowledge gap through a nationwide population-based analysis. METHODS Patients who underwent liver resection (LR) for HCC were identified from Surveillance, Epidemiology and End Results (SEER-18) database (2003-2015). Cohort-based clinicopathologic comparisons were made based on completion of regional LNS. Propensity-score matching reduced bias. Overall and disease-specific survival (OS/DSS) were analyzed. RESULTS Among 5395 patients, 835 (15.4%) underwent regional LNS. Patients undergoing LNS had larger tumors (7.0vs4.8 cm) and higher T-stage (30.9 vs. 17.6% T3+, both p < 0.001). Node-positive rate was 12.0%. Median OS (50 months for both) and DSS (28 vs. 29 months) were similar between cohorts, but node-positive patients had decreased OS/DSS (20/16 months, p < 0.01). Matched patients undergoing LNS had equivalent OS (46 vs. 43 months, p = 0.869) and DSS (27 vs. 29 months, p = 0.306) to non-LNS patients. The prognostic impact of node positivity persisted after matching (OS/DSS 24/19 months, p < 0.01). Overall disease-specific mortality were both independently elevated (overall HR 1.71-unmatched, 1.56-matched, p < 0.01; disease-specific HR 1.40-unmatched, p < 0.01, 1.25-matched, p = 0.09). CONCLUSION Regional LNS is seldom performed during resection for HCC, but it provides useful prognostic information. As the era of adjuvant therapy for HCC begins, surgeons should increasingly consider performing regional LNS to facilitate optimal multidisciplinary management.

Abstract
BACKGROUND Intracholecystic papillary neoplasm (ICPN) of the gallbladder (GB) is an exophytic intraepithelial neoplasm. This study aimed to investigate clinicopathologic findings, prognosis and recurrence patterns of patients with ICPN as compared to those patients with conventional adenocarcinoma of the gallbladder (GBC). METHODS Patients who underwent surgical resection for suspected GB cancer between 2000 and 2018 were included. ICPN was defined as an exophytic papillary mass within the GB lumen with a size ≥1.0 cm. RESULTS Of 607 patients, 241 patients (40%) were pathologically diagnosed with ICPN. Of the 241 patients with ICPNs, 110 (46%) were T1 or less. Following T stage-matched analysis, the rate of lymph node metastases were comparable (50 [52%] vs. 37 [49%], P = 0.581). The five-year survival rate was higher in ICPN, but after T stage-matching, they were comparable (69.1 vs. 63.2%, P = 0.171). Overall recurrence rates were also comparable, with the exception of lower peritoneal seeding in patients with ICPN. CONCLUSION Patients with ICPN who underwent resection were more likely to have an earlier T stage. There was no significant difference in prognosis and recurrence between ICPN and conventional GBC after stage matching. Therefore, the treatment strategy for ICPN should follow the same protocols used for conventional GBC.

Abstract
INTRODUCTION Lymphadenectomy (LND) is recommended following surgical resection of ≥ T1b gallbladder cancer (GBC). However, frequency and stage-specific survival benefits of LND remain unclear. PATIENTS AND METHODS The National Cancer Database (NCDB; 2006-15) was queried for resected pathologic stage I-III GBC. LND performance, predictors of receiving LND, and LND association with overall survival (OS) were assessed. RESULTS Of 2302 total patients, 1343 (58.3%) underwent LND. Patients who underwent LND were younger and more frequently had private health insurance, a negative surgical margin, higher pathologic T stage, and received adjuvant chemotherapy (all p < 0.001). LND rates were highest at academic centers (70.1%) relative to all other facility types (p < 0.001). LND was independently associated with improved OS [hazard ratio (HR) 0.52, 95% confidence interval (CI) 0.44-0.61]. LND was associated with improved OS for pT1b, pT2, and pT3 patients (all p < 0.05) on univariate analysis. LND was independently associated with improved OS in pT2 (HR 0.44, CI 0.35-0.56) and pT3 (HR 0.54, CI 0.43-0.69) patients. CONCLUSIONS LND is associated with a 48% reduction in risk of death in patients with resectable non-metastatic GBC, with greatest impact in pT2-3 patients. Patients without LND have similar OS to patients with node-positive disease, highlighting the importance of LND. Underutilization of LND likely results in undertreatment of patients with undiagnosed nodal disease, which may contribute to unfavorable oncologic outcomes.

Abstract
The scope of our study was to compare the predictive ability of American Joint Committee on Cancer (AJCC) 7th and 8th edition in gallbladder carcinoma (GBC) patients, investigate the effect of AJCC 8th nodal status on the survival, and identify risk factors associated with the survival after N reclassification using the National Cancer Database (NCDB) in the period 2005-2015. The cohort consisted of 7743 patients diagnosed with GBC; 202 patients met the criteria for reclassification and were denoted as stage ≥III by AJCC 7th and 8th edition criteria. Overall survival concordance indices were similar for patients when classified by AJCC 8th (OS c-index: 0.665) versus AJCC 7th edition (OS c-index: 0.663). Relative mortality was higher within strata of T1, T2, and T3 patients with N2 compared with N1 stage (T1 HR: 2.258, p < 0.001; T2 HR: 1.607, p < 0.001; Τ3 HR: 1.306, p < 0.001). The risk of death was higher in T1-T3 patients with Nx compared with N1 stage (T1 HR: 1.281, p = 0.043, T2 HR: 2.221, p < 0.001, T3 HR: 2.194, p < 0.001). In patients with AJCC 8th edition stage ≥IIIB GBC and an available grade, univariate analysis showed that higher stage, Charlson-Deyo score ≥ 2, higher tumor grade, and unknown nodal status were associated with an increased risk of death, while year of diagnosis after 2013, academic center, chemotherapy. and radiation therapy were associated with decreased risk of death. Chemotherapy and radiation therapy were associated with decreased risk of death in patients with T3-T4 and T2-T4 GBC, respectively. In conclusion, the updated AJCC 8th GBC staging system was comparable to the 7th edition, with the recently implemented changes in N classification assessment failing to improve the prognostic performance of the staging system. Further prospective studies are needed to validate the T2 stage subclassification as well as to clarify the association, if any is actually present, between advanced N staging and increased risk of death in patients of the same T stage.

Abstract
Background Gallbladder cancer is a rare but highly malignant cancer, which often progresses to a metastatic stage when diagnosed because of its asymptomatic manifestation. In this study, we intended to analyze the prognostic value of metastatic gallbladder adenocarcinoma (GBA) with site-specific metastases. Methods Using the Surveillance, Epidemiology, and End Results (SEER) database, GBA patients diagnosed with metastases between 2010 and 2016 were selected to identify the prognosis according to the isolated metastatic sites, including liver, lung, bone, brain and distant lymph nodes (DL). Kaplan–Meier methods were used for survival comparisons and multivariable Cox regression models were constructed to find out independent factors that associated with survival. Results Data from 1526 eligible patients were extracted from the SEER database. Among the patients, 788 (51.6%) had isolated liver metastases, 80 (5.2%) had isolated distant nodal involvement, 45 (2.9%) had isolated lung metastases, 21 (1.4%) had isolated bone metastases, 2 (0.1%) had isolated brain metastases and 590 (38.7%) had multiple metastases. No significant survival difference was shown between patients with single or multisite metastases (P > 0.05). Patients with isolated lung or DL metastases had significant better survival outcomes than those with isolated bone metastases (P < 0.05). Multivariate analysis showed that performing surgery at primary site, receiving chemotherapy were associated with better OS and CSS for patients with isolated liver or DL metastases. Conclusions The study showed that different metastatic sites affect survival outcomes in metastatic GBA patients. Highly selected subset of patients with liver or DL metastases might benefit from surgery at primary site.

Abstract
Gallbladder cancer is the most common malignancy of the biliary tract. It is also the most aggressive biliary tumor with the shortest median survival duration. Complete surgical resection, the only potentially curative treatment, can be accomplished only in those patients who are diagnosed at an early stage of the disease. Majority (90%) of the patients present at an advanced stage and the management involves a multidisciplinary approach. The role of imaging in gallbladder cancer cannot be overemphasized. Imaging is crucial not only in detecting, staging, and planning management but also in guiding radiological interventions. This article discusses the role of a radiologist in the diagnosis and management of gallbladder cancer.

Abstract
BACKGROUND AND OBJECTIVES Tumor location (peritoneal vs hepatic) has been incorporated in the 8th edition of the American Joint Committee on Cancer Staging system for gallbladder cancer. However, larger studies are needed to confirm the prognostic impact of tumor location. METHODS Patients with pathologically-confirmed gallbladder cancer with information on primary tumor location were included from the National Cancer Database (2009-2012). We compared patients with hepatic-side tumors to those on the peritoneal side. Survival data were plotted using the Kaplan-Meier method. Prognostic factors were modeled with a multivariate Cox Proportional Hazards Model. Primary outcome was overall survival (OS). RESULTS A total of 1251 patients were included. In comparison to patients with peritoneal-sided tumors, patients with hepatic-sided tumors were more likely to: be of higher pT stage (pT3: 49% vs 24%; P < .001); node positive (31% vs 24%; P = .016); undergo liver resection (53% vs 25%; P < .001); or have positive margins (29% vs 16%; P < .001). However, on multivariate analysis, there was no difference in OS between the groups (HR, 0.97; 95% CI, 0.79-1.18; P = .753). Liver resection was associated with improved survival regardless of tumor location in pT2 tumors (peritoneal: HR, 0.57; P = .034; hepatic: HR, 0.67; P < .001). CONCLUSIONS This study failed to demonstrate the independent prognostic value of primary tumor location in patients with gallbladder cancer.

Abstract
PURPOSE The 8th edition of the American Joint Commission on Cancer (AJCC) Staging System for gallbladder cancer (GBC) has been used in clinical practice, but we have found some deficiencies in this edition. METHODS Survival analyses were performed to evaluate the application of various editions of the AJCC staging systems using the Surveillance, Epidemiology, and End Results (SEER) database (N = 9616 patients) and Fudan University Zhongshan Hospital (FUZH) database (N = 327 patients). A modified staging system was proposed based on the 8th edition of the AJCC Staging System. RESULTS Although all N2 diseases were grouped into stage IVB as M1 in the 8th edition, some patients with N2 diseases could undergo R0 resection, and had longer survival than patients with M1 diseases had in both cohorts (p < 0.001 in SEER, p = 0.041 in FUZH). Furthermore, in the SEER database, stage IIIA patients aberrantly had poorer survival than stage IIIB patients had (p < 0.001). Therefore, we proposed a modified staging system by rearranging the substages. N2 disease was subdivided and reappraised according to T stage, and the aberrant survival reversal of stage IIIA and stage IIIB disease was also corrected. Through our modification, the C-index of the 8th AJCC Staging System was elevated from 0.596 [95% confidence interval (CI): 0.585-0.607] to 0.623 (95% CI: 0.612-0.634) for local disease in the SEER cohort. Similar findings were also observed in the FUZH cohort. CONCLUSION Our modified 8th AJCC Staging System is more suitable for GBC and could be adopted for clinical practice.

Abstract
BACKGROUND Although the current nodal staging system for gallbladder cancer (GBC) was changed based on the number of positive lymph nodes (PLN), it needs to be evaluated in various situations. METHODS We reviewed the clinical data for 398 patients with resected GBC and compared nodal staging systems based on the number of PLNs, the positive/retrieved LN ratio (LNR), and the log odds of positive LN (LODDS). Prognostic performance was evaluated using the C-index. RESULTS Subgroups were formed on the basis of an restricted cubic spline plot as follows: PLN 3 (PLN = 0, 1-2, ≥ 3); PLN 4 (PLN = 0, 1-3, ≥ 4); LNR (LNR = 0, 0-0.269, ≥ 0.27); and LODDS (LODDS < - 0.8, - 0.8-0, ≥ 0). The oncological outcome differed significantly between subgroups in each system. In all patients with GBC, PLN 4 (C-index 0.730) and PLN 3 (C-index 0.734) were the best prognostic discriminators of survival and recurrence, respectively. However, for retrieved LN (RLN) ≥ 6, LODDS was the best discriminator for survival (C-index 0.852). CONCLUSION The nodal staging system based on PLN was the optimal prognostic discriminator in patients with RLN < 6, whereas the LODDS system is adequate for RLN ≥ 6. The following nodal staging system considers applying different systems according to the RLN.

Abstract
Gallbladder cancer (GBC) is an often lethal disease, but surgical resection is potentially curative. Symptoms may be misdiagnosed as biliary colic; over half of new diagnoses are made after laparoscopic cholecystectomy for presumed benign disease. Gallbladder polyps >1 cm should prompt additional imaging and cholecystectomy. For GBC diagnosed after cholecystectomy, tumors T1b and greater necessitate radical cholecystectomy. Radical cholecystectomy includes staging laparoscopy, hepatic resection, and locoregional lymph node clearance to achieve R0 resection. Patients with locally advanced disease (T3 or T4), hepatic-sided T2 tumors, node positivity, or R1 resection may benefit from adjuvant chemotherapy. Chemotherapy increases survival in unresectable disease.
